<p>More Polymorphic Typing issues were discovered in jackson-databind. When
Default Typing is enabled (either globally or for a specific property)
for an externally exposed JSON endpoint and the service has JDOM 1.x or
2.x or logback-core jar in the classpath, an attacker can send a
specifically crafted JSON message that allows them to read arbitrary
local files on the server.</p>

<p>For Debian 8 <q>Jessie</q>, these problems have been fixed in version
2.4.2-2+deb8u7.</p>

<p>We recommend that you upgrade your jackson-databind packages.</p>
